PacisClassPass Mock Corpus: A Synthetic Classroom Engagement Dataset for Reproducibility
收藏资源简介:
Synthetic classroom-engagement corpus supporting the study Agentic AI in Higher Education: Building a Custom Classroom Engagement Platform Through AI-Assisted Software Engineering (Pacis, 2026, under review at Educational Technology & Society). The corpus contains 91 files (1.3 MB uncompressed) generated deterministically with seed = 42, comprising 565 mock users, 78 quiz items, and 3,485 mock quiz responses distributed across baseline, small-cohort, and geofence scenarios. Purpose. This dataset lets reviewers and readers reproduce every numerical claim in §4 and §7 of the paper without access to any live classroom system. It is paired with the PacisClassPass Load Generation and Verification Bundle (separate Zenodo deposit) which consumes the corpus and reproduces the reported latency and throughput figures. Contents. mock-data/R0-baseline/ — baseline scenario (users, quiz items, quiz responses, location pings, selfie events, session manifest). mock-data/R1-small-cohort/ — small-cohort scenario. mock-data/R10-geofence-70/ — geofence variant at 70 m radius; additional geofence scenarios follow the same pattern. Each scenario directory contains manifest.json, users.jsonl, quiz-items.jsonl, quiz-responses.jsonl, location-pings.jsonl, selfie-events.jsonl, and session.json. Regeneration. The corpus is reproducible from source using the companion software deposit: node generate-mock-dataset.mjs --seed 42 Safety and ethics. No human-subjects data were collected. All records are synthetic and generated by seeded pseudorandom functions. The study is IRB-exempt under BYU–Hawaii policy, and the paired software refuses to execute unless the environment variable EVAL_MODE=mock is set. Recommended citation. Pacis, A. (2026).
